Geraldton in Western Australia is a city in Western Australia’s Coral Coast is a 4.5 hour drive north of Perth, or a quick 50 minute flight with Qantas. With a beautiful Mediterranean climate, the sun shines almost all the time. In winter the temperature averages around 20C and 33C in summer. It makes for the perfect beach lifestyle

In Geraldton you will find the National Memorial commemorates the loss of The HMAS Sydney II and the ships company of 645 men on 19th November 1941 in battle with German ship HSK Kormoran. Overlooking the Indian Ocean, the Museum of Geraldton celebrates the rich heritage of the land, sea and people of the Mid West region.
